Diamond Chocolate Factory

A cooperative factory at Victoria making chocolate from Grenadian cocoa on the island.

The Diamond factory at Victoria was set up as a cooperative between Grenadian cocoa farmers and a partner in the trade, with the point being that the beans grown on the island are also processed on it rather than shipped away raw. The tour runs through fermentation, drying, roasting, conching and moulding in a small working plant, and ends in a tasting of the bars made under the Jouvay name.

What you actually see

  • The full process - fermentation through to moulding under one roof.
  • The cooperative model - farmers holding a stake in the processing.
  • The working plant - a small factory rather than a demonstration set-up.
  • The tasting - the Jouvay bars made from the beans on the island.

When to go

Year round. Tours run on set days and hours and booking ahead is sensible. Production is heavier around the two cocoa harvests.

Honest expectations

Tours run on limited days and the factory is sometimes not in production when visited. It is small and the visit is short. The tour ends in a shop.
